Your Role

We are actively seeking a computer hardware engineer to work hands-on with advanced hardware systems such as GPUs, AI accelerators, and thermal test vehicles. This role will lead the testing and evaluation of thermal interface materials (TIMs), the core product line at Boston Materials. Typical activities include tearing down / modifying computer hardware, writing software (Python, CUDA, etc.) to control / interface with high-powered chips, and interpreting and processing data streams (primarily thermal) from PC cards, servers, and specialized hardware. You will play a large role in the assembly, operation, data collection, and overall system optimization for thermal stress tests.

Your Responsibilities

  • Teardown and modifications of electronics such as computers, laptops, GPU cards, AI accelerators, and thermal test vehicles.
  • Hands-on work with mechanical assemblies, wiring, material testing, usage of general power tools.
  • Conduct experiments and tests (such as overclocking and stress testing) on thermal interface materials to evaluate their performance and properties.
  • Optimize data collection, processing, and analysis from testing equipment.
  • Automate data collection wherever possible.
  • Influence design and fabricate tooling / fixtures, incorporating CAD, 3D printing, milling / CNC, and waterjetting.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ve material performance and manufacturing processes.
  • Participate in design reviews and provide feedback on engineering designs.
  • Help maintain laboratory equipment and ensure a safe working environment.
  • Document all work according to company protocols and industry standards.
  • Stay updated on the latest advancements in computer technology and thermal management.
